The Rimac Nevera is a pure electric GT hypercar that is as capable on track as it is crossing continents. Configurable, personal and extremely powerful, the Nevera is the perfect example of what is possible when true innovation and passion are allowed free rein. Developing on the knowledge attained from Rimac Concept One, the all-new Rimac Nevera connects the greatest materials and personalised technology to form a product that is both innovative and extremely practical.
Designed by Rimac’s in-house team, the Nevera captures Rimac’s unmistakable styling features – such as the signature ‘tie’ design on the flanks – demonstrating timeless, elegant design. Rimac’s hypercar also incorporates a variety of all-new, groundbreaking technologies, such as a full carbon fibre monocoque with bonded carbon roof, integrated battery pack and merged rear carbon subframe. The hypercar’s body is pure carbon fibre and crash structures are formed from aluminium, resulting in both a light and exceptionally strong structure.
Internally, the hypercar features a triplet of high-definition TFT screens (cluster, central screen and co-driver’s display), as well as a host of elegantly tactile billet aluminium rotary controls and switches – providing the driver with a resolutely analogue feel tailored to make use of cutting-edge digital technology. Other electronic elements incorporated by Rimac include real-time telemetry information (downloadable to digital devices) and a Driving Coach configuration, which is capable of overlaying selected race tracks in real-time.
